Bomb manuals, suspected steroids and a copy of Adolf Hitler’s “My New Order” were among the items seized during the recent FBI raids targeting Hutaree, federal search warrant records show.

.................

Agents seized military uniforms, a ballistic helmet, samurai sword, crossbow, parachute flares and other items. Investigators also seized audio of “The Turner Diaries,” which is a novel that militia watchdog groups say provided inspiration to Oklahoma City bomber Timothy McVeigh. In addition, agents seized a CD, “Explosives, Ordnance & Demolitions,” and the book “My New Order” by Adolf Hitler, records show. Investigators also recovered 46 firearms and more than 13,000 rounds of ammunition, documents show.
